A tornado touched down in Michigan’s Thumb near Deckerville this past Saturday. The Deckerville tornado puts the total tornado tally at 30 tornadoes so far for 2025.
The National Weather Service said the tornado in Deckerville was on the ground from 4:18 p.m. to 4:21 p.m., with a length of 1.58 miles and a max width of 100 yards.
